Find hands-on exploration and engaging programming in visual arts, music and performance, natural science, and world cultures inspired by Brooklyn’s energy and diversity at the world’s first children’s museum, founded in 1899.
🌎 Learn about world cultures, visual arts, nature, animals and more in well-designed, interactive exhibits including World Brooklyn, Neighborhood Nature, Totally Tots, Collections Central and The (outdoor) Nest.
🌀 Investigate opposites through hands-on experiences, art-making, and performances in Opposites Abstract: A Mo Willems Exhibit, inspired by the eye-popping, emotive, and highly accessible words and images in Mo Willems’ bestselling children’s book of the same name.
🎨 In the ColorLab, try print-making, collage and sculpture projects inspired by artists such as Elizabeth Catlett, Richard Hunt, Faith Ringgold and Kehinde Wiley.
🪹 Play, climb, and explore the intersection of nature and the urban environment outdoor interactive playscape The NEST.
🎉 Look for lots of special programs and festivals with community organizations.
